Skyrora tests Skylark-L

Scottish launch startup Skyrora has performed a static fire test of a rocket in the U.K. for the first time in five decades

Known as the Skylark-L, the liquid-fueled suborbital rocket measures 11 meters tall and is equipped with a single-engine. In the successful test, the rocket was held securely to the ground while the engine fired for 22 seconds, simulating a launch to space.

Skyrora has over the past few months been looking into launching from Iceland.
